D Rocket Design MaximX Flipper!

Image

The scales are a red fiberglass high voltage electrical insulator material and the blade is VG10. I wish I knew more information about the scale material but it’s fairly unique. In a way it reminds me of old melamine resin kitchenware or some type of vintage urethane bowling ball. In short, it has a retro appearance that I’m a big fan of.

Overall first impressions are great though. It has good flipping action, feels solid in hand, and has a secure lockup. I’ll take more pictures in better lighting soon, I just wanted to get one up after unboxing it.

The other in my other pocket.

The new Schrade company released a few traditional knives that are made in the US. Quality is somewhere closer to Case than it is to GEC. I applaud Schrade for moving some production back home and supported their efforts with a purchase.
